Challenges in Translating Specialized Scientific Terminology
Translating laboratory reports and scientific data accurately presents a unique set of challenges due to the specialized nature of the terminology involved. Scientists and researchers often employ highly technical terms, acronyms, and jargon that are specific to their field, making precise communication across languages complex. What may seem like a straightforward term in one language can have multiple interpretations or no direct equivalent in another, leading to potential errors or misunderstandings.
For instance, scientific concepts like “biomarker” or “pharmacokinetics” require careful consideration during translation as they are field-specific and might not translate directly. Professional translators specializing in science and medicine play a vital role here, ensuring that these technical terms are accurately conveyed while maintaining the integrity of the original data. They stay updated with industry-specific terminologies to deliver high-quality translations that meet international standards, making global collaboration in research and development seamless.
Quality Assurance Protocols for Effective Translation Services
When translating laboratory reports and scientific data, ensuring accuracy and consistency is paramount. Quality Assurance (QA) protocols play a pivotal role in this process, guaranteeing that the translated content meets stringent international standards. These protocols involve rigorous review processes, where every aspect of the translation is scrutinized by experts.
The QA team verifies the technical precision of terms related to specific scientific domains, ensuring they are correctly rendered into the target language. They also cross-check formatting and layout to maintain the report’s structural integrity. By implementing these stringent measures, certified translators can deliver reliable translations that accurately convey laboratory findings and scientific data across global contexts.

The Role of Human Translators in Refining Computer-Assisted Translations
In the realm of global communication, where laboratory reports and scientific data must transcend borders, human translators play an indispensable role in refining computer-assisted translations (CAT). While CAT tools are efficient for handling large volumes of text, they often struggle with the nuances and context specific to complex scientific terminology. Human experts, armed with specialized knowledge in both languages and science, step in to ensure accuracy and clarity. They meticulously review machine-generated translations, identifying instances where cultural references or specialized concepts have been misinterpreted.
These translators bring a level of subtlety and contextual understanding that machines cannot replicate. They ensure that the translated text not only conveys the literal meaning but also captures the intended scientific message accurately. By serving as a bridge between technology and expertise, human translators enhance the overall quality of global scientific communication, fostering seamless collaboration and data exchange across borders for laboratory reports and scientific data.
